Transaction a87587584cd96c02883878f533bee87bbce959b87e229b4515e91be9354fd484

1 Input
2 Outputs
  • a87587584cd96c02883878f533bee87bbce959b87e229b4515e91be9354fd484:0
  • value  24825
    address  183sh2D65xDFRtLpso28L3Pksab5kPdQwp
  • a87587584cd96c02883878f533bee87bbce959b87e229b4515e91be9354fd484:1
  • value  2935800
    address  1D73CuAe6nWim8LTdrRUKTkf8KcQYDzLKX